#3028c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3028c6 is composed of 18.8% red, 15.7%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.8%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 243 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 46.7%. #3028c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#6050ff with #00008d.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#3028c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3028c6 has RGB values of R:48, G:40,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 3156166.

Shades and Tints of #3028c6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f1f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3028c6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72717d is the less saturated color, while #0f03eb is the most saturated one.
